Top 10 Best Part-Time Jobs for International Students in 2025
Here are the most popular and practical jobs for students studying abroad:
1. Barista or Café Assistant
Working in a coffee shop is a great option. You get to meet people, learn customer service, and enjoy free coffee!
Pros: Flexible shifts, fun environment
Skills Needed: Basic English, friendly attitude
2. Library Assistant
Many colleges and universities hire students to work in campus libraries. Tasks include sorting books, helping other students, or managing the front desk.
Pros: Quiet setting, easy to manage with studies
Skills Needed: Organization, attention to detail
3. Tutor
If you are good at a subject like math, science, or language, you can help other students by becoming a tutor. You can also teach your native language.
Pros: High hourly pay, flexible timing
Skills Needed: Good subject knowledge, patience
4. Retail Store Assistant
Working at clothing stores, supermarkets, or local shops can help you earn money and improve your communication skills.
Pros: On-the-job training, team experience
Skills Needed: Customer service, basic math
5. Delivery Driver or Rider
If you have a bike or scooter, delivery jobs for food or packages are popular and easy to get. Apps like Uber Eats or DoorDash are commonly used.
Pros: Flexible work hours, tips
Skills Needed: Local navigation, driving license (in some countries)
6. Freelancer (Writing, Graphic Design, Web Help)
If you have creative or technical skills, freelancing online is one of the best part-time jobs for international students in 2025. You can work from your room and pick your own hours.
Pros: Work from home, high earning potential
Skills Needed: Skill in writing, design, coding, or marketing
7. Event Staff or Promoter
Colleges often need students to help with events or shows. You can help with setting up events, ticketing, or guiding guests.
Pros: Fun experience, short-term gigs
Skills Needed: Energy, communication
8. Data Entry Assistant
Some companies offer simple online data entry work. You can do this job remotely and at your own pace.
Pros: No special degree needed, flexible hours
Skills Needed: Typing, focus
9. Receptionist or Admin Assistant
Offices and clinics sometimes need help managing calls, bookings, or emails.
Pros: Good pay, professional setting
Skills Needed: English speaking, computer basics
10. On-Campus Jobs (Lab Assistant, Dorm Helper, Tech Support)
Working on campus can save travel time. Many schools hire their own students for tech help, office work, or dorm management.
Pros: Convenient location, safe environment
Skills Needed: Depends on the role
